In 2009, Commentary Track gained three new writers, published 105 movie reviews, made 52 DVD recommendations, and added “Thinking Outside the Multiplex” as a regular Friday feature.

Our five most popular reviews were of Public Enemies, The Crow, Nausicaa of the Valley of the Wind, Body Heat, and Grindhouse.

Not coincidentally, the top  search terms that brought people to the site were “The Crow” and “Public Enemies.” Those were closely followed by perennial favorite “Desperado” (searchers were rewarded with James’ haiku), while the top referrer was the IMDb’s external reviews page for Gamer.
